OOFEN:
The OOFEN bit enables the receive out of frame indication to automatically
generate a receive failure indication in the transmit stream. This bit operates
regardless of the format selected (T1 or E1). When OOFEN is logic 1,
declaration of the OOF alarm causes a yellow alarm (T1) or remote alarm
indication (E1) to be transmitted for the duration of the OOF alarm. When
OOFEN is logic 0, assertion of the OOF alarm does not cause transmission
of a receive failure indication.
LOSEN:
The LOSEN bit enables the receive loss of signal indication to automatically
generate a receive failure indication in the transmit stream. This bit operates
regardless of the format selected (T1 or E1). When LOSEN is logic 1,
declaration of the LOS alarm causes a yellow alarm (T1) or remote alarm
indication (E1) to be transmitted for the duration of the LOS alarm. The LOS
alarm is removed when the pulse density requirements for the T1 or E1
format are satisfied. When LOSEN is logic 0, assertion of the LOS alarm
does not cause transmission of a receive failure indication.
TAISEN:
When the T1 or E1 format is selected, the TAISEN bit enables the generation
of an unframed all-ones AIS alarm on the TDP/TDD[x] and TDN/TOHO[x]
multifunction pins. When TAISEN is set to logic 1 and TUNI is set to logic 0,
the bi-polar TDP[x] and TDN[x] outputs are forced to pulse alternately,
creating an all-ones signal; when TAISEN and TUNI are both set to logic 1,
the uni-polar TDD[x] output is forced to all-ones. When TAISEN is set to logic
0, the TDP/TDD[x] and TDN/TOHO[x] multifunction outputs operate normally.
The transition to transmitting AIS on the TDP[x] and TDN[x] outputs is done in
such a way as to not introduce any bipolar violations.
